Herc Rentals, a leading equipment rental company in North America, has acquired Rental Works of Maryland, an independent equipment rental company serving the Maryland, Washington D.C., and Northern Virginia markets in the US. This acquisition marks Herc Rentals’ continued growth and expansion in key metropolitan markets.
Rental Works of Maryland was founded in 2007 and operates four branches. The managing partner, David Graham, expressed excitement about the acquisition and highlighted the shared values between the two companies. “We are thrilled to join forces with Herc Rentals,” said Graham. “Their focus on enhancing the customer experience, managing fleet efficiency and expenses, and expanding their network aligns perfectly with our mission.”
Herc Rentals completed four acquisitions in the first quarter of the year, opening 11 new locations and four greenfield locations. The company’s total fleet was valued at approximately $6.4 billion as of March 31, with an average fleet age of 47 months. With over 400 locations across North America, Herc Rentals is ranked third on the RER 100 list and reported total revenues of approximately $3.3 billion in 2023.
Larry Silber, president and CEO of Herc Rentals, stated that the company is making progress towards its key priorities for 2024. “This acquisition is a crucial step towards achieving our goals,” said Silber. “We are committed to providing our customers with exceptional service and value while continuing to grow our business through strategic partnerships like this one.”
Catalyst Strategic Advisors served as the exclusive transaction advisor to Rental Works of Maryland throughout the acquisition process.
